  1. Rodrigues Formula for Jacobi Polynomials on the Unit Circle

    We begin by discussing properties of orthogonal polynomials on a Borel measurable subset of the complex plane. Then we focus on Jacobi polynomials and give a formula (analogous to the one discovered by R. D. Costin) for finding Jacobi polynomials on the unit circle. Finally, we consider some …
